A year later, Teng Xuan left the juvenile detention center in a wheelchair.
Teng Wei came to pick him up wearing a faded tracksuit. He hadn’t shaved, his shoes weren’t polished, he looked much thinner, and his eyes were covered with crow’s feet. In just twelve months, he seemed to have aged many years.
Teng Xuan stared blankly at his father, who was in utter destitution.
“Let’s go.” Teng Wei didn’t say a word of concern, shoved the person into a dilapidated second-hand car, and drove towards the low-rent housing outside the city.
“Dad, my ALS was caused by poisoning! Someone poisoned me!” Teng Xuan said urgently. “Dad, take me to the hospital. Didn’t Zhuang Li invent a gene repair drug? That drug can cure me!”
“I know who poisoned you. When you were seven, you went to celebrate Xiu Yue’s birthday. What did you say to him?” Teng Wei asked with utmost calmness.
In fact, after the bankruptcy, he went to the Si family to cause trouble. The old man played several recordings for him, and he was filled with despair. He couldn’t believe that his son would harm others when he was so young, but when he thought of Zhuang Li, who was almost tricked into committing suicide, he felt that this seemed to be his son’s true nature.
It was his neglect of his son’s moral education that led to this tragedy. He was the one who made the biggest mistake, and he had no one else to blame but himself.
Teng Xuan paused for a second before shaking his head and saying, “Who remembers what happened when I was seven? Dad, why are you asking this?”
“Was Madam Si’s death related to you? Was Si Ming’s paralysis also your fault? Because of you, I’ve already been bankrupted by Old Master Si. And because of you, Zhuang Li has completely left the Teng family. You still want to buy his medicine to cure your illness? You’d better dream on!”
Teng Wei took a deep breath and continued, “Do you know how much that drug costs? Twenty million US dollars per injection, and I can’t even come up with two hundred dollars right now.”
“I was thinking that now that you’re out, I’d take you to kneel and kowtow to Zhuang Li, hoping he’d give you an injection out of consideration for the years I raised him. Unfortunately, I don’t even know where he lives.”
“Zhuang Xin is his biological mother. She’s searched everywhere but can’t even see him. How could I possibly do that? You may have forgotten the things you did to him back then, but he definitely hasn’t. He’s more vengeful than anyone else. So just give up and live your life like this.” Teng Wei pulled the car over to the side of the road and buried his face in the steering wheel, sobbing uncontrollably.
How could he not be heartbroken that his son was paralyzed? But what good was his grief? He didn’t even know who to turn to for justice for his son. He finally believed in the saying that every evil has a cause.
Teng Xuan stared blankly at the back of his father’s head, his eyes widening as if he had seen something terrifying.
Fragments of the past flashed before his eyes, then were sucked into a black hole by a vortex, swallowing everything around him. Was this his future? Hopeless and helpless, forever plunged into the abyss?
No, no, no, there is still hope, there is definitely still hope!
“Where is Xiu Yue? Does he know I came out today?” Teng Xuan asked in a trembling voice.
“Xiu Yue?” Teng Wei wiped the mess off his face and sneered, “He’s paralyzed as well, his mother ran away with all the money, and his father is doing odd jobs everywhere. He doesn’t even have money to buy him medicine. It doesn’t matter if you don’t admit it, Xiu Yue has admitted it all.”
“He confessed everything shortly after he became paralyzed, saying that it was your idea to kill Madam Si. Teng Xuan, you were only seven years old and you already knew how to kill. Are you my son? Or are you a reincarnation of a demon?” At this point, Teng Wei suddenly became afraid and turned to look at his son, the pity in his eyes slowly fading.
As Teng Xuan watched those eyes gradually lose their warmth, he vaguely saw that black hole once again. It had expanded!
Three years later, due to lack of money to treat their deteriorating health, Xiu Yue and Teng Xuan died of respiratory failure one after the other.
One night, Zhuang Li heard 7480’s reminder: “Master, a cheat device has fallen nearby. Please retrieve it quickly.”
Following the location signal, Zhuang Li arrived at a dilapidated residential building and saw Teng Wei guarding the corpse. He was so thin that he was unrecognizable, with the bones in his cheeks protruding high and his face deeply sunken, like a walking corpse.
Seeing the handsome young man who had grown up considerably, Teng Wei was stunned. After a long while, he shakily got up, bowed at a ninety-degree angle, and sincerely said, “It seems that I still owe you an apology for back then.”
The last time he saw Zhuang Li, he said all sorts of nice things, but he didn’t say the three words “I’m sorry”.
Zhuang Li waved his hand without speaking, walked past the aged Teng Wei, and went to the stained wire bed, brushing his hand across Teng Xuan’s face from a distance.
Teng Xuan immediately closed his wide-open eyes.
Teng Wei thought Zhuang Li had come to see his son off, and he was so moved that he burst into tears.
Zhuang Li took out a bank card and placed it next to Teng Wei. Then he slowly walked out without turning his head and said, “This is the tuition fee that the Teng family paid for me back then. I’m returning it to you. The password is six zeros. Actually, I should have given it to you back then, but I was busy with experiments and forgot.”
As he reached the door, he waved and said, “Goodbye.”
Teng Wei clutched the bank card tightly, his sobs growing louder. To him now, this card was undoubtedly the most precious gift, a lifeline for someone about to drown.
He staggered to his feet and chased after the young man, but he had already disappeared.
At the same time, 7480 was detecting the cheat device while reporting the situation to the host: “It’s a D-level cheat device, the Eye of Causality.”
Sitting in the back seat of the car, Zhuang Li closed his eyes and muttered to himself, “The Eye of Causality? Can one see cause and effect with just a pair of eyes? Seeing the Cycad Fruit, he could see Madam Si’s death and Si Ming’s paralysis; and seeing the online diary, he could see the original owner’s suicide by cutting his wrists?”
“Probably. Let me take a look at the script.”
7480 flipped through the script with a rustling sound, exclaiming, “Master, there’s a passage in the script like this. Xiu Yue couldn’t handle a big deal, so he asked Teng Xuan to step in. Teng Xuan carefully examined the big client and then told him that he absolutely couldn’t take a certain road the next day. The client listened to Teng Xuan’s advice, avoided a car accident, and the big deal was closed. Teng Xuan’s eyes really can see cause and effect.”
“He must have used those eyes to get rid of a lot of people, right? What a sin!” Zhuang Li casually said as he put the golden finger into the energy bar, “Burn it.”
Just as he was about to persuade him to leave the Eye of Causality behind: “…” The Great Demon King must be the most domineering host in history, without exception!
“Actually, the Eye of Causality is quite useful because we might have to travel to a supernatural world. Supernatural worlds are different from the real world, and many of the difficulties there are beyond the reach of science and technology. Master, next time you encounter such a cheat ability, you must handle it with caution,” 7480 offered a sincere suggestion.
“I believe science can solve everything, so why don’t we give it a try?” Zhuang Li smiled with interest: “The supernatural world? That must be really fun.”
